Fresh off the back of the success at the Boston Marathon, PUMA’s Project3 participants made waves as they shaved a combined 2 hours, 51 minutes and 19 seconds off their collective personal best times at the 2025 London Marathon.
Ninety runners from nine countries raced across the capital wearing the newly launched Fast-R NITRO™ Elite 3, producing staggering results in the process.
A total of 39 runners set a personal best, with 23 of them besting their previous best by over three minutes, making them eligible for a $3000 cash prize from Puma. In total, PUMA will pay out $78,000 to Project3 runners.
It was a day to remember for Lucy Jones, who finished first in the mass participation field, recording a time of 2:30:23, while knocking a mindblowing 22 minutes and 31 seconds off her previous marathon record. This result means she will take home a total prize of $9000 as the fastest Project3 female, breaking her previous record by more than three minutes and being the Project3 runner with the biggest time improvement.

Another athlete recording a personal best in the new Fast-R shoes was Christa Cain of the Isle of Man. With a 2:37:25, she also recorded a new women’s Isle of Man record.
The shoes have recently been the subject of a study, where results indicated they could be up to 3.15% more efficient than competitor supershoes.
In January, PUMA launched Project3, a first-of-its-kind global running program that offered participants of the 2025 Boston and London Marathons the opportunity to experience life as a professional athlete and trial the Fast-R NITRO™ Elite 3, with the chance to bank huge performance-based cash prizes.
